Leatherback
  Sea Turtle

 Season Can
   Start Any
      Day!

EAGLE BEACH - Have
you noticed the turtle
information signs along
the Boulevard at Eagle
Beach--one in front of
Paradise Beach Villa’s
and another one close
to Costa Linda Beach Re-
sort? The signs are called
“Driekiel-O-Meter” with
information about the
Leatherback Sea Turtles
(locally called Driekiel).
The Leatherback Sea
Turtles nesting on Aruba
don’t live in the Carib-
bean, but in the North-
ern part of the Atlantic
Ocean, off the coast of
Nova Scotia, Canada.
But they are born on Aru-
ba’s beaches. After 20
